Abstract
We obtain new nonexistence results of generalized bent functions from \{Z^n}_q to (called type ) in the case that there exist cyclotomic integers in with absolute value . This result generalize the previous two scattered nonexistence results of Pei \cite{Pei} and of Jiang-Deng \cite{J-D} to a generalized class. In the last section, we remark that this method can apply to the GBF from to .
